DLL files, or Dynamic Link Libraries, are essential components of software applications on Windows systems. They contain code and data that multiple programs can use simultaneously, promoting efficiency and reusability. The micro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ll file is specifically related to the Windows Azure platform and is responsible for enabling synchronization commands.

Users might encounter issues with this DLL file, such as missing or corrupt file errors, which can disrupt the proper functioning of Azure-related applications. Understanding and managing DLL files is crucial for maintaining a healthy and stable computer system.

DLL files often play a critical role in system operations. Despite their importance, these files can sometimes source system errors. Below we consider some of the most frequently encountered faults associated with DLL files.

  • Micro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message indicates that the DLL file is either not compatible with your Windows version or has an internal problem. It could be due to a programming error in the DLL, or an attempt to use a DLL from a different version of Windows.
  • Cannot register micro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ll: This error is indicative of the system's inability to correctly register the DLL file. This might occur due to issues with the Windows Registry or because the DLL file itself is corrupt or improperly installed.
  • Micro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ll Access Violation: The error signifies that an operation attempted to access a protected portion of memory associated with the micro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ll. This could happen due to improper coding, software incompatibilities, or memory-related issues.
  • Micro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ll could not be loaded: This means that the DLL file required by a specific program or process could not be loaded into memory. This could be due to corruption of the DLL file, improper installation, or compatibility issues with your operating system.
  • This application failed to start because microsoft.windowsazure.commands.sync.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This message suggests that the application is trying to run a DLL file that it can't locate, which may be due to deletion or displacement of the DLL file. Reinstallation could potentially restore the necessary DLL file to its correct location.
